Форум программистов, компьютерный форум, киберфорум
C для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.69/13: Рейтинг темы: голосов - 13, средняя оценка - 4.69
26 / 26 / 7
Регистрация: 18.11.2011
Сообщений: 266
1

Как написать Dll В Dev c++

13.01.2012, 13:31. Показов 2555. Ответов 8
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
здравстывуйте . проштудировал весь инет но нечего ненашел немогли бы помоч
0
Лучшие ответы (1)
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
13.01.2012, 13:31
Ответы с готовыми решениями:

Как подключить dll библиотеку в компиляторе Dev C++
Здравствуйте, вопрос заключается в следующем, как подключить dll библиотеку в компиляторе Dev C++?...

Как подключить dll к консольной программе в Dev-CPP ?
Здравствуйте. Написал библиотеку в Qt Creator. Подключаю её к консольной программе, написанной в...

pdh.dll & Dev C++
господа пытаюсь из pdh.dll загрузить функцию - NtQuerySystemInformation , но проблемма dll грузится...

Подключение dll к проекту в среде Dev C++
Добрый день, Первый день с Dev c++ Мне нужно к проекту подключить dll библиотеку. Как это...

8
32 / 32 / 4
Регистрация: 19.12.2011
Сообщений: 72
13.01.2012, 23:18 2
Лучший ответ Сообщение было отмечено Памирыч как решение

Решение

C
1
2
3
4
__declspec(dllexport) int MyCoolFunction(int a, int b)
{
  /* Тело функции. */
}
Компилишь как DLL. Юзаешь.
2
26 / 26 / 7
Регистрация: 18.11.2011
Сообщений: 266
14.01.2012, 00:27  [ТС] 3
Цитата Сообщение от kisssko Посмотреть сообщение
Компилишь как DLL. Юзаешь.
но там 2 файла открывается что со вторым ?
0
6045 / 2160 / 753
Регистрация: 10.12.2010
Сообщений: 6,005
Записей в блоге: 3
14.01.2012, 00:32 4
Цитата Сообщение от Ilyawow Посмотреть сообщение
но там 2 файла открывается что со вторым ?
Я так понял вы имеете ввиду *.lib-файл и *.dll-файл. Первый нужен в случае, если вы будете работать с вашей библиотекой статически. При динамической работе он не нужен.
0
26 / 26 / 7
Регистрация: 18.11.2011
Сообщений: 266
14.01.2012, 01:10  [ТС] 5
там файлы *.с и *.h
0
6045 / 2160 / 753
Регистрация: 10.12.2010
Сообщений: 6,005
Записей в блоге: 3
14.01.2012, 01:18 6
Цитата Сообщение от Ilyawow Посмотреть сообщение
там файлы *.с и *.h
И? Моих телепатических способностей не хватает. Что вы в них написали?
0
26 / 26 / 7
Регистрация: 18.11.2011
Сообщений: 266
14.01.2012, 01:24  [ТС] 7
я нечего неписалиеще потому что не понимаю как туда функции вбивать поэтому и к вам обращаюсь
0
6045 / 2160 / 753
Регистрация: 10.12.2010
Сообщений: 6,005
Записей в блоге: 3
14.01.2012, 01:28 8
Цитата Сообщение от Ilyawow Посмотреть сообщение
я нечего неписалиеще потому что не понимаю как туда функции вбивать поэтому и к вам обращаюсь
Тогда, считаю, вам до длл рано. Учите матчасть.
0
32 / 32 / 4
Регистрация: 19.12.2011
Сообщений: 72
15.01.2012, 04:13 9
Цитата Сообщение от Ilyawow Посмотреть сообщение
но там 2 файла открывается что со вторым ?
Создаём пустой проект, или удаляем .h файл.

Цитата Сообщение от Ilyawow Посмотреть сообщение
потому что не понимаю как туда функции вбивать поэтому и к вам обращаюсь
Как вбивать функции я написал. Так же, как и обычные, но в начале __declspec(dllexport)
1
15.01.2012, 04:13
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
15.01.2012, 04:13
Помогаю со студенческими работами здесь

Создание динамической библиотеки (dll) в Dev C++
Кто умеет создавать dll библиотеки в Dev C++, вопрос к вам. Дело в том что я умею создавать header...

Как написать DLL на VB?
Описываю функцию/процедуру в ActiveX DLL, компилирую в NewDll.Dll, но потом не могу получить доступ...

Как написать DLL и другое
Здравствуйте! Появилась мысль написать прогу, которая имеет 2 DLL файла и потом типо пропатчить ее...

Как написать функцию в ActiveX DLL и как её использовать в другой проге?
Как написать функцию в ActiveX DLL и как её использовать в другой проге, ну допустим как апи:...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
9
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ru